1. Bank Loans

Many traditional banks offer specialized loans for yacht purchases. These loans often come with competitive interest rates and extended repayment periods. When applying for a bank loan, it’s advisable to present a solid business plan that outlines your charging strategy, maintenance costs, and projected revenues from chartering the yacht. Make sure to shop around for various banks to find the best terms available.

2. Marine Financing Companies

Marine financing companies specialize in providing loans specifically for boats and yachts. These lenders understand the maritime industry and often have flexible options tailored to yacht buyers. They may require less stringent credit evaluations than traditional banks, making them an attractive choice for many buyers.

3. Personal Loans

If you’re looking for a quicker and less bureaucratic solution, personal loans may be an option. However, it’s essential to compare interest rates and terms, as they can vary widely. Personal loans typically rely on your creditworthiness and income, so ensure you have a good credit score to secure favorable rates.

4. Leasing Options

Leasing a yacht can be a smart alternative if you want to avoid the upfront costs of purchasing a vessel. With a leasing agreement, you effectively rent the yacht for a specified period, allowing you to enjoy the benefits without the long-term commitment. Many leasing companies can offer maintenance packages as part of the lease, which can be financially advantageous.

5. Charter Income Financing

Some finance companies allow you to use projected charter income as collateral for securing a loan. This means you can take out a loan based on your expected earnings from chartering your yacht in Croatia. It’s vital to provide detailed and accurate projections to avoid any issues with repayment.

6. Crowd Funding

Crowd funding has become a popular method for financing various projects, including yacht purchases. Platforms that specialize in marine investments can connect you with potential investors who are willing to fund a portion of your yacht purchase in exchange for a share of the charter income. This method can diversify your financing sources and lessen your initial financial burden.

7. Partnership or Syndicate Financing

Pooling resources with friends or family to purchase a yacht is a practical option. This method not only helps share costs but also reduces the financial risks for each individual. Establish clear agreements regarding maintenance, usage rights, and chartering to prevent potential disputes down the line.
